The question says it all. I’ve google-searched, but can find any explanation offered for why Holling’s disc equation is called a ‘disc’ equation. https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Functional_response

Quoting from http://www.tiem.utk.edu/~gross/bioed/bealsmodules/holling.html:

“Holling's disk equation, named after experiments he performed in which a blindfolded assistant picked up sandpaper disks from a table, describes the type II functional response.”

Holling's original article about this from 1959 is officially here, behind a paywall, but Google also found another pdf.
